Skip to content

Commit

Permalink
[NET_SCHED]: sch_hfsc: replace ASSERT macro by WARN_ON
Browse files Browse the repository at this point in the history
Signed-off-by: Patrick McHardy <kaber@trash.net>
Signed-off-by: David S. Miller <davem@davemloft.net>
  • Loading branch information
Patrick McHardy authored and David S. Miller committed Feb 13, 2007
1 parent a10d567 commit 3d50f23
Showing 1 changed file with 1 addition and 14 deletions.
15 changes: 1 addition & 14 deletions net/sched/sch_hfsc.c
Original file line number Diff line number Diff line change
Expand Up @@ -71,8 +71,6 @@
#include <asm/system.h>
#include <asm/div64.h>

#define HFSC_DEBUG 1

/*
* kernel internal service curve representation:
* coordinates are given by 64 bit unsigned integers.
Expand Down Expand Up @@ -211,17 +209,6 @@ do { \
} while (0)
#endif

#if HFSC_DEBUG
#define ASSERT(cond) \
do { \
if (unlikely(!(cond))) \
printk("assertion %s failed at %s:%i (%s)\n", \
#cond, __FILE__, __LINE__, __FUNCTION__); \
} while (0)
#else
#define ASSERT(cond)
#endif /* HFSC_DEBUG */

#define HT_INFINITY 0xffffffffffffffffULL /* infinite time value */


Expand Down Expand Up @@ -1492,7 +1479,7 @@ hfsc_schedule_watchdog(struct Qdisc *sch, u64 cur_time)
if (next_time == 0 || next_time > q->root.cl_cfmin)
next_time = q->root.cl_cfmin;
}
ASSERT(next_time != 0);
WARN_ON(next_time == 0);
delay = next_time - cur_time;
delay = PSCHED_US2JIFFIE(delay);

Expand Down

0 comments on commit 3d50f23

Please sign in to comment.